What you’ll learn
- Introduction to autism and key terminology
- Communication and social interaction differences
- How autistic people may experience the world
- Approaches and strategies to support individuals
- You’ll explore what autism is, how autistic people may experience the world, and practical approaches to support individuals effectively. This is a non-accredited course however it can be an excellent foundation for the Level 3 qualification.
